I am studying the production of 6He in the 7Li (gamma, p) reaction by
using 22 MeV electron and I am having the following questions:
  1) I calculated 6He yield using Fluka : 1.4E7 ± 9.8% atoms / s and
calculated using GEANT4 and received 1.25E7 atoms / s. Since I did not
know how to get the cross section using Fluka, I did it with GEANT4 and
noticed that the cross section is 10 times smaller than the experimental
(I looked in EXFOR). Analytically, too, it has been tested and the yield
was about 2E8 atoms / s. It has been checked experimentally, it is also
more than estimates of these programs. And I can not understand why
Fluka gives such results? And I do not know how this can be explained,
is it concerned with libraries?
